Exercise Regularly

Regular exercise is crucial for overall health and well-being. It helps to improve cardiovascular health, maintain a healthy weight, and boost mood and confidence.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ate exercise each day, such as walking, jogging, yoga, or strength training. Find activities that you enjoy and make them a regular part of your routine.

Eat a Balanced Diet

A balanced diet is essential for fueling your body and providing it with the nutrients it needs to function properly. Focus on eating a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. Limit your intake of processed foods, sugary snacks, and high-fat foods. Stay hydrated by drinking plenty of water throughout the day.

Manage Stress

Stress can take a toll on both your physical and mental health. Find healthy ways to manage stress, such as deep breathing exercises, meditation, journaling, or spending time in nature. Make time for self-care activities that bring you joy and relaxation, such as reading a book, taking a bath, or practicing a hobby.

Get Adequate Sleep

Sleep is essential for overall health and well-being. Aim for 7-8 hours of quality sleep each night to recharge your body and mind. Create a bedtime routine that helps you unwind and prepare for restful sleep, such as turning off electronic devices, dimming the lights, and practicing relaxation techniques.

Listen to Your Body

Pay attention to your body’s signals and cues. If you are feeling tired, sore, or unwell, take the time to rest and recover. Pushing yourself too hard can lead to burnout and injury. Listen to your body’s needs and adjust your exercise routine, diet, and lifestyle accordingly.

Consult with Healthcare Professionals

Regular check-ups with healthcare professionals, such as your primary care physician, gynecologist, and dentist, are important for maintaining your overall health. Keep up-to-date on recommended screenings, vaccinations, and preventive care measures to catch any potential health issues early and prevent more serious conditions.
